CORNETTO 1 . A Renaissance musical instrument resembling a flute or a snake. It has no relation to the current bugle 2 . In gastronomy: from the Italian 'horn' and 'cornetto vuoco' horn. It is made of cone-shaped pastry dough, eggs, mantequiila, water and sugar. It can be filled with pastry cream, damask jam or chocolate xrema 3. Ice cream brand created by a Neapolitan factory in 1959. Unilever bought it in 1970 and it is marketed worldwide under the Heartbrand brand.
